Victoria Falls | Mosi-oa-Tunya

One of the most iconic natural Wonders of the world is the Victoria Falls, known locally as Mosi-oa-Tunya translating into ‘The Smoke That Thunders’. Whilst exploring this unique land back in 1852 and 1856, Dr. David Livingstone named the falls after the reigning British monarch at the time; Queen Victoria.

This UNESCO World Heritage Site has the largest curtain of falling water in the world, it’s over 1708 m wide and up to 500 million liters of water cascades over the basalt rocks per minute at certain times of the year. There are 8 spectacular gorges that the water flows over and there are several islands in the core zone that serve as breeding sites for endangered and migratory bird species.

When to go

December - March

Better known as the ‘Emerald Season’ these are the rainy months and also the height of summer. The mighty Zambezi River will slowly start rising from January and the falls itself will begin to pick up in power. Dramatic thunderstorms are present some afternoons. The weather is hot and humid, with temperatures reaching well over 30 °C in the daytime. The white-water rafting season usually closes around February in due to high water levels and the famous Livingstone Island and Devil's Pool in Zambia often closes in January/February due to the dangerously high water levels.

April – June

The Falls is at its fullest at this time of the year. This is also the only time of year that the Lunar Rainbow can be viewed at its best. The spectacle lasts from sunset to sunrise and is one of Africa's best kept secrets. During these months the Zambezi is in flood and the Falls are at their most magnificent in both Zambia and Zimbabwe, however visibility on foot from some of the lookouts can be limited by the abundance of spray and mist. Temperatures during the day are warm at 25-30 °C. This is also the best time for a helicopter flight over the falls.

July – August

These months bring the peak season at the falls, with lower water levels and less spray allowing for excellent visibility of the mighty falls. Activities such as Livingstone Island, rafting and devil’s pools open again as soon as the water drops. Although this is peak wintertime, you can expect warm and sunny days 20-28 °C, but it’s best to bring warm layers for the cool evening temperatures.

September – November

These months mark the end of the dry season and this is when the falls are at their lowest, drying up to reveal the intricate rock formations, however, there is still excellent visibility from the Zimbabwe side. This time of year is perfect for white-water river rafting and the Livingstone Island. The weather is very hot, averaging at around 35-40 °C.
